What does Goodwin mean and where does it come from?
Goodwin is of English origin and translates to 'good friend' or 'good fortune'. The name heralds from Old English roots: 'god' meaning good and 'wine' meaning friend. Goodwin has been used since the Middle Ages, although it is often more recognized as a surname than a first name. Emphasis on friends
